Get it checked ASAP: Hello, Without knowing more about you, it's important to get this checked out with a 12 lead EKG by your doctor especially when the symptoms are occurring. You could have a wide variety of possible heart "arrythmias" (abnormal rhythms) like SVT, atrial fibrillation or PAC's. Some of these can be quite dangerous and can lead to serious problems, even death.

Depends: Palpitations or fluttering can have many causes and many implications. Some are minor and some can be life threatening. This complaint would be best addressed at an Emergency Room where they can test your heart, check your rhythm and determine why you are having fluttering. Good luck
